Step-by-step explanation:

Solve for x over the real numbers:

x^2 - 4 x - 5 x = 0

x^2 - 4 x - 5 x = x^2 - 9 x:

x^2 - 9 x = 0

Factor x from the left hand side:

x (x - 9) = 0

Split into two equations:

x - 9 = 0 or x = 0

Add 9 to both sides:

Answer: x = 9 or x = 0

Theory - Roots of a product :

3.1    A product of several terms equals zero.  

When a product of two or more terms equals zero, then at least one of the terms must be zero.  

We shall now solve each term = 0 separately  

In other words, we are going to solve as many equations as there are terms in the product  

Any solution of term = 0 solves product = 0 as well.
